Wanxiang Pavilion

A neutral institution set up by the imperial court.

It was primarily responsible for managing the changes and dissemination of various rankings. As a major city, Xunyang had a branch of Wanxiang Pavilion. Many people chose to challenge the experts on the rankings here, particularly when exciting events occurred.

At this moment, the square outside Wanxiang Pavilion was already packed with people. On ordinary days, the place was relatively quiet, but now that a good show was about to take place, no one wanted to miss it. Many influential figures from the prominent families of Xunyang City had also come out to watch.

"Do you think Yuan Nongbai can succeed in the challenge?" someone in the crowd asked.

"Of course, Yuan Nongbai is a disciple of the Academy, and at the ninth level of the True Aperture Realm. How could he possibly lose to Feng Qinghe?"

"I don't think so. If Yuan Nongbai were that powerful, why hasn't he made it onto the rankings yet?"

"True, but not every genius is interested in the rankings," someone replied, nodding in agreement.

"Moreover, Yuan Nongbai is from the Academy's Inner Palace, so his strength should be above Feng Qinghe's."

People generally held the view that the Academy's cultivation methods were superior, far beyond those of sects.

"You're living in the past. The power of sects is no longer what it used to be," someone countered. "Just look at the rankings—sect experts now occupy a third of the spots, or even more!"

At these words, the crowd fell silent. Indeed, from the rankings, it was clear that the power of sects had surged in recent years. The Academy no longer held the unchallenged lead it once did.

At a nearby tavern.

The usually lively three-story tavern was nearly empty, except for seven people sitting at a table. Their attire alone revealed their extraordinary status.

"Interesting, I didn't expect to have a side performance today," said a handsome young man dressed in a python robe, gently putting down his teacup with a faint smile at the corner of his lips.

"Yuan Nongbai, he must be a descendant of the Yuan family, right?" The young man turned to a middle-aged man sitting next to him.

The middle-aged man stood up respectfully. This was the head of the Yuan family, one of the most powerful martial artists in Xunyang City. He immediately bowed and smiled, saying, "Young one, you're too kind. I hope we are not disturbing His Highness, the Ninth Prince."

"Of course not, I'm quite interested in watching the talents of the Yuan family," replied the Ninth Prince with a smile.

He had been in Xunyang City for several days now. Unfortunately, the most important figure, the Blood Brave Marquis, was not present. According to some confidential information, the Marquis wouldn't be arriving for a while, so the Ninth Prince had to focus his attention on other influential families in the city.

The Seven Prefectures of Chang Le, though far from the imperial capital, had produced many strong martial artists due to their proximity to the Outer Sea and the Southern Wilderness. It was well worth the Ninth Prince's attention.

Upon hearing the Ninth Prince's words, the other family heads exchanged glances, their thoughts racing. They hadn't thought of this angle. If they wanted to align themselves with the Ninth Prince, they should have sent their young heirs to show their faces. It was clear that Yuan Nongbai's challenge today was no simple matter—it was part of a larger plan.

"The word is that Feng Qinghe's master is a senior elder from the Xuantian Sword Sect. Yuan family head, be careful not to choose the wrong opponent," one of the family heads warned.

"One month ago, my son encountered someone ranked 15th on the Potential Dragon Ranking during a trial. He easily defeated him," Yuan family head said with a proud smile, stroking his beard. "But we chose not to publicize it."

At this, the family head from the Wang family fell silent. If Yuan Nongbai could easily defeat someone ranked 15th, Feng Qinghe, ranked 17th, would be no challenge at all.

It was clear that the Yuan family head had carefully prepared for this challenge. Everything was planned with precision.

Meanwhile, at the square.

The crowd had grown even larger, and the tension in the air was palpable. Luo Mu and Cheng Qingman also arrived.

"Junior Brother Luo, Junior Sister Cheng!" Lin Rufeng waved from the crowd.

Jiang Hai was with him as well. The two had been out shopping but couldn't resist coming to watch when they heard about the challenge.

"It's quite a coincidence," Cheng Qingman remarked as they joined up.

"Yes, who would've thought it would be Yuan Nongbai," Lin Rufeng said excitedly. "Isn't he usually focused on his cultivation and uninterested in rankings? Why is he suddenly challenging someone?"

"I don't know," Cheng Qingman shook her head.

"Do you think Yuan Nongbai can win?" Lin Rufeng asked.

"Yuan Nongbai's strength is without question. In the Inner Palace, he is one of the top geniuses. Only Junior Brother Luo here could possibly stand up to him," Cheng Qingman said.

Yuan Nongbai had cultivated mid-tier Mystic martial arts, after all.

"I don't know much about Feng Qinghe, so I'm not sure," Cheng Qingman continued.

"Let's hope Yuan Nongbai wins. The opponent he chose is quite problematic. If it were any other family's genius, it wouldn't matter as much, but Feng Qinghe? Does he not know that Feng Qinghe is backed by the ever-growing Xuantian Sword Sect?" Jiang Hai remarked. "If he loses, it won't just be embarrassing for him."

Cheng Qingman and Lin Rufeng both fell silent. They hadn't considered it from that angle. This challenge was much more serious than they initially thought.

At that moment, two figures appeared on the square.

The once-boisterous crowd began to quiet down, their attention now fully on the two newcomers.

"Yuan Nongbai, you have quite the nerve to challenge me," Feng Qinghe said, his voice cold.

He stood Great with a long sword on his back. His face was thin, and his narrow, snake-like eyes gave off an air of menace.

"Enough talking. Today, I'm taking your place," Yuan Nongbai replied, holding a massive broad-bladed sword that looked like a giant door.

Yuan Nongbai had no real interest in the challenge, but his father had insisted that he face Feng Qinghe. After all, it was rumored that the Ninth Prince harbored a deep grudge against sects, and if Yuan Nongbai could defeat a sect genius, his family would gain considerable favor with the prince.

Yuan Nongbai and Feng Qinghe had long-standing personal issues, and today seemed like the perfect time to settle them.

Having defeated someone ranked 15th, defeating Feng Qinghe, ranked 17th, was no challenge at all. So there is no suspense in today's battle.
